What to Eat

Ferrara is known for its cuisine, which is a mix of Italian and Austrian influences. Here are some of the must-try dishes:

  • Cappellacci di zucca: A pumpkin-filled pasta.
  • Salama da sugo: A pork sausage.
  • Pasticcio di maccheroni: A macaroni casserole.
  • Zuppa inglese: A trifle-like dessert.

Where to Go

Here are some of the must-see places in Ferrara:

  • Castello Estense: A 14th-century castle.
  • Cattedrale di San Giorgio: A 12th-century cathedral.
  • Palazzo dei Diamanti: A 15th-century palace.
  • Via delle Volte: A street with covered arcades.
  • Piazza Ariostea: A square with a statue of the poet Ludovico Ariosto.
